Megami-ryou no Ryoubo-kun

 

The dormitory full of goddesses finally finds its matron with the TV anime adaptation of Ikumi Hino‘s ecchi harem comedy manga Megami-ryou no Ryoubo-kun series finally confirming its premiere date. The official Twitter account for the series announced today that the anime will premiere on July 14 in Japan alongside outline how the series will be broadcast.

 



 


 


The above tweet reveals that the series will have three different versions; an “upholding the public morals” modified version which will air on TV, a “see-through” version that will be streamed a week after the first version on streaming services in Japan, and then an “uncensored” version that will air on cable channel AT-X.

Megami-ryou no Ryoubo-kun


 

The story follows 12-year-old boy Koushi Nagumo who becomes the matron of a women’s college dormitory after being homeless and finds the residents to be quite …  interesting. Shunsuke Nakashige (Sword Art Online: Alicization – War of Underworld episode director) serves as director of Megami-Ryou no Ryoubo-Kun, alongside the series composition writer Masashi Suzuki (Plunderer) and the character designer Maiko Okada (I Couldn’t Become a Hero, So I Reluctantly Decided to Get a Job. chief animation director). The series will be animated at Asread (Big Order) and is scheduled to start on July 14 at 23:05 on cable, and then later on at 25:05 on TOKYO MX (effectively 1:05 AM on July 15).
